The quiet surroundings of the Circle of Hope Girls Ranch, once touted as a haven for at-risk youth, have been shattered by harrowing accounts from survivors who bravely share their stories. These young women, now speaking out against the abuse they endured, are shedding light on the hidden scars that long-term institutional care can leave behind.
Through their narratives, a picture emerges of systemic issues within the ranch’s walls—a place where trust was betrayed and innocence was stolen. The experiences vary, but the common thread is the profound emotional and psychological trauma inflicted upon vulnerable adolescents. Survivors describe a lack of support, physical and emotional neglect, and abusive practices that left them feeling isolated, frightened, and unable to escape their circumstances. These stories are a powerful reminder that behind closed doors, hidden crises can fester, impacting young lives forever.
The Circle of Silence: Breaking Free from Secrecy
Many survivors of abuse at the Circle of Hope Girls Ranch have long lived in a “Circle of Silence,” bound by secrecy and fear. This culture of silence, often enforced through threats and manipulation, kept victims from sharing their stories and seeking justice for decades. The weight of this silence was crushing, allowing abusers to evade accountability and continue causing harm.
Breaking free from the Circle of Silence is a powerful act of liberation and healing. Survivors are now coming forward with their stories, shedding light on the hidden abuse that took place within the walls of what was supposedly a place of safety and support. By speaking out, these individuals not only reclaim their voices but also play a crucial role in preventing future atrocities, ensuring transparency, and holding perpetrators accountable for their actions.
A Call for Justice: Holding Ranch Accountable
The stories shared by survivors of Circle of Hope Girls Ranch abuse have sparked a collective cry for justice. As more individuals come forward, detailing their experiences of physical, emotional, and sexual misconduct at the hands of ranch officials, the need for accountability becomes increasingly pressing. The silence that once surrounded these atrocities can no longer be ignored; the voices of the victims demand attention and action.
Holding Circle of Hope Ranch accountable is a critical step towards healing and preventing future harm. Survivors deserve justice, not just for their individual experiences but also as a way to send a clear message: such abuse will not be tolerated. It’s essential to ensure that those responsible are held accountable through legal avenues and that systemic changes are implemented to protect vulnerable individuals in similar care settings.
